Historically, many crypto launchpads operated simply as digital ticket booths. A project would complete its initial token sale, the tokens would be listed on an exchange, and the platform would immediately transition its focus to the next upcoming raise. This "fundraise-and-forget" approach leaves early-stage development teams highly vulnerable during their most critical window: the post-Token Generation Event (TGE) price discovery and community stabilization phases.

1. Why Single-Transaction Launchpads Fail Founders

When a project relies on a transactional launchpad exchange or standard presale venue, they are often left to navigate market volatility completely alone the moment trading goes live. Without specialized advisory, projects frequently run into immediate roadblocks:

  • Severe Liquidity Fragmentation: Improper cross-chain liquidity deployment can split a token's trading volume across separate pools, resulting in high slippage and rapid price manipulation.
  • The Post-Hype Community Vacuum: Once the initial presale marketing push ends, engagement rates routinely drop if the launch platform lacks the infrastructure to transition short-term speculative participants into actual utility users.

5. Frequently Asked Questions

What exactly is the difference between a presale venue and an ecosystem enabler?

A standard presale venue acts merely as a transaction broker—once tokens are sold, its involvement concludes. An ecosystem enabler, like Kommunitas, actively supports the protocol's long-term health through ongoing marketing assistance, multi-chain integration consulting, and partnership outreach well after trading begins.

How do multi-chain capabilities improve post-launch stability?

Launching across multiple chains allows a project to source liquidity from diverse Web3 ecosystems simultaneously while lowering transaction gas fees for retail participants on highly efficient layers like Polygon and BNB Chain.

Why is smart contract auditing vital for post-launch safety?

An unaudited or poorly structured contract leaves the project open to exploits, honey-pots, or proxy modifications that can instantly ruin community trust. Partnering with launchpads that mandate audits through reputable external firms minimizes code vulnerabilities from day one.
